This position is 100% in the office. You will manage a criminal case calendar and will provide legal assistance/paralegal support to the attorneys at our firm. You’ll assist with the preparation and/or filing of legal documents, handling office correspondence, including answering phone calls and emails, corresponding with courts, reminding the team of upcoming deadlines, and other administrative roles as needed. We use MyCase case management software, and experience with MyCase will help dramatically with transitioning into this job.

Oversee client case files with tasks such as preparing and organizing client files, adding upcoming hearings to the calendar, saving all relevant documents to the client's case file, and client correspondence regarding court dates and other related matters

Oversee criminal calendars and related tasks such as preparing conflict letters and tables for team calendar meetings, keeping up with the calendar for the upcoming weeks, filing conflict letters, and corresponding with courts and/or judicial staff to assist with resetting hearings

Oversee office correspondence and administrative tasks such as answering phone calls, communicating with clients and court staff, responding to emails, and reminding the team of upcoming deadlines

Keeping up with client billing and contacting clients about outstanding invoices

E-filing and/or mailing court documents to courts, the prosecuting attorney's office, and other parties as needed
